Transaction 299b566934feaaf3931414545fbd221c876a2f3c7bacfd31896deda28a68c38b
1 Input
1 Output
-
299b566934feaaf3931414545fbd221c876a2f3c7bacfd31896deda28a68c38b:0
- value
- 391286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ff8ae990cb977ca764af0090b7bb11664edf8631 OP_EQUAL
- address
- 3QzCeG5sBsZBqysNfd1xjUQPfraCZk8bDh